Cuscuta umbellata (Flatglobe Dodder) is a species of annual herb in the family Convolvulaceae. They are climbers. They are native to Puerto Rico, Rio Grande Do Norte, The Contiguous United States, U.S. Virgin Islands, and Ceará.
